What medications do women take for left arm pain

Women’s left arm pain may be caused by trauma, muscle strain, infection, carpal tunnel syndrome and other factors, you can take anti-inflammatory analgesic drugs, antibiotics, nutritive nerve drugs and muscle relaxants. 1. Trauma: When a woman’s left arm is hit by a hard object resulting in soft tissue contusion, fracture, etc., it will cause arm pain, which can be relieved by non-steroidal drugs such as ibuprofen, meloxicam, and other pain relieving drugs. 2. Muscle strain: If chronic muscle strain in the wrist can be caused by long-term manual labor or long wrist activities, which can lead to pain, anti-inflammatory and analgesic drugs can be chosen, but also muscle relaxants such as Eperisone, etc., to relieve muscle spasms. 3. Infection: bacterial infection can also cause redness, swelling and pain in the left arm of women, you can take antibiotic drugs such as amoxicillin as prescribed by the doctor to reduce the inflammatory response. 4. Carpal Tunnel Syndrome: It is a disease caused by the compression of the median nerve in the carpal tunnel, which can cause pain and numbness in the wrist, etc. You can choose non-steroidal anti-inflammatory and analgesic drugs, as well as nutritive neurotics such as methylcobalamin and vitamin B12 to alleviate the symptoms of nerve compression. There are many other causes of left arm pain in women. Patients with symptoms of prolonged left arm pain should go to the hospital in time for examination and treatment, and medication should be taken under the guidance of a doctor, not private medication.
